Course Details

• Unit 1: Introduction to Financial Econometrics & Correspondence Regression Analysis
• Unit 2: Data Analysis & Preprocessing for Financial Time Series
• Unit 3: Simple Linear Regression & Model Assessment
• Unit 4: Multiple Linear Regression & Hypothesis Testing
• Unit 5: Time Series Analysis & Stationarity Concepts
• Unit 6: Autoregressive (AR), Moving Average (MA), & ARIMA Models
• Unit 7: Vector Autoregression (VAR) & Vector Error Correction Models (VECM)
• Unit 8: Conditional Autoregressive (CAR) & Generalized Autoregressive Conditional Heteroskedasticity (GARCH) Models
• Unit 9: Application of Econometric Models in Financial Forecasting
• Unit 10: Model Validation, Selection, & Performance Evaluation
